What do I need to know to help?

mzEasy is primarily written in R, but does use a minimal amount of system calls for sending commands to msconvert.exe

If you would like to contribute but aren't comfortable with R, that's ok! You can always submit a pull request for fixing/updating or making the documentation more clear. That misght be issues you have found, but you can also check unresolved Documentation Issues.

If you are interested in making a code contribution I would suggest that you be comfortable with - At the minimal: R
